From 2e6d14c36a15a4fb5324d4717c78b494f34dfa53 Mon Sep 17 00:00:00 2001
From: Richard Fuchs <rfuchs@sipwise.com>
Date: Thu, 26 Jan 2023 11:55:18 -0500
Subject: [PATCH] MT#56469 fix ng-client ptime/db-id options

These are integer options, not string options.

Change-Id: I592590e77fd0f7d15cb63fa8400ef54bc321d4e9
---
 utils/rtpengine-ng-client |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/utils/rtpengine-ng-client b/utils/rtpengine-ng-client
index ea10e1450..e8b5c9e96 100755
--- a/utils/rtpengine-ng-client
+++ b/utils/rtpengine-ng-client
@@ -127,7 +127,7 @@ my $cmd = shift(@ARGV) or die;
 
 my %packet = (command => $cmd);
 
-for my $x (split(/,/, 'from-tag,to-tag,call-id,transport protocol,media address,ICE,address family,DTLS,via-branch,media address,ptime,xmlrpc-callback,metadata,address,file,db-id,code,DTLS-fingerprint,ICE-lite,media echo,label,set-label,from-label,to-label,DTMF-security,digit,DTMF-security-trigger,DTMF-security-trigger-end,trigger,trigger-end,all,frequency')) {
+for my $x (split(/,/, 'from-tag,to-tag,call-id,transport protocol,media address,ICE,address family,DTLS,via-branch,media address,xmlrpc-callback,metadata,address,file,code,DTLS-fingerprint,ICE-lite,media echo,label,set-label,from-label,to-label,DTMF-security,digit,DTMF-security-trigger,DTMF-security-trigger-end,trigger,trigger-end,all,frequency')) {
 	if (defined($options{$x})) {
 		if (!$options{json}) {
 			$packet{$x} = \$options{$x};
@@ -137,7 +137,7 @@ for my $x (split(/,/, 'from-tag,to-tag,call-id,transport protocol,media address,
 		}
 	}
 }
-for my $x (split(/,/, 'TOS,delete-delay,delay-buffer,volume,trigger-end-time,trigger-end-digits,DTMF-delay')) {
+for my $x (split(/,/, 'TOS,delete-delay,delay-buffer,volume,trigger-end-time,trigger-end-digits,DTMF-delay,ptime,db-id')) {
 	defined($options{$x}) and $packet{$x} = $options{$x};
 }
 for my $x (split(/,/, 'trust address,symmetric,asymmetric,unidirectional,force,strict source,media handover,sip source address,reset,port latching,no rtcp attribute,full rtcp attribute,loop protect,record call,always transcode,SIPREC,pad crypto,generate mid,fragment,original sendrecv,symmetric codecs,asymmetric codecs,inject DTMF,detect DTMF,generate RTCP,single codec,no codec renegotiation,pierce NAT,SIP-source-address,allow transcoding,trickle ICE,reject ICE,egress')) {